With less and less people using their mobiles to actually make a telephone call, have we lost the art of the phone call altogether? 

Justine O’Mahoney, Columnist with the Wexford People, has been writing about her nostalgia for a time when the landline was the beating heart of the family home. She joins Seán to discuss.
